N9805
|
Name: Atglk1.1 |
Price:
£11.00
|
Donor
- University of Nottingham Kevin Pyke
- University of Nottingham Mark Waters
|
Locus
|
Photo
|
Stock type: individual line
|
Material type: seed
|
|
Description SLAT lines containing dSpm insertions were screened for independent insertions in AtGLK1 (At2g20570). Once identified, southern blot analysis determined each line contained a single insertion, and lines were then screened for homozygous individuals. Related stock: N9806, N9807.
|
Phenotype
Essentially indistinguishable from wild type (AtGLK1 is redundant to AtGLK2)
|
N9806
|
Name: Atglk2.1 |
Price:
£11.00
|
Donor
- University of Nottingham Kevin Pyke
- University of Nottingham Mark Waters
|
Locus
|
Photo
|
Stock type: individual line
|
Material type: seed
|
|
Description SLAT lines containing dSpm insertions were screened for independent insertions in AtGLK2 (At5g44190). Once identified, southern blot analysis determined each line contained a single insertion, and lines were then screened for homozygous individuals. Related stock: N9805, N9807.
|
Phenotype
Essentially indistinguishable from wild type (AtGLK2 is redundant to AtGLK1) EXCEPT that immature siliques are pale green.
|
N9807
|
Name: Atglk1.1;glk2.1 |
Price:
£11.00
|
Donor
- University of Nottingham Kevin Pyke
- University of Nottingham Mark Waters
|
Locus
|
Photo
|
Stock type: individual line
|
Material type: seed
|
|
Description Homozygous Atglk1.1 and homozygous Atglk2.1 individuals were crossed to produce a homozygous double mutant. Related stock: N9805, N9806.
|
Phenotype
Plants are pale green throughout development and reduced in size. Chloroplast development impaired and photosystem II proteins accumulate to reduced levels.

N9808
|
Name: CCR2:LUC W1 |
Price:
£11.00
|
Donor
- University of Edinburgh Andrew Millar
- University of Edinburgh Adrian Thomson
|
|
Stock type: individual line
|
Material type: seed
|
|
Description Fusion of CCR2 (AtGRP7, At2g21660) upstream region to the LUC+ firefly luciferase reporter gene (from Promega), as described in Doyle et al. (2002) Nature 419: 74-77. This is one of the independent transgenic lines used in Doyle et al. (2002) Nature. It is the transgenic parent used in crossing the CCR2:LUC marker into other mutant backgrounds, including the cca1-11; lhy-21 double mutant (stock N9380) reported in Locke et al. (2006) Molecular Systems Biology, 2:59. Parent was probably N2360. Self-fertilized since initial transformation. Homozygous family selected from a line that segregated for a single insertion.
|
|
N9809
|
Name: F4cca1lhyCCR2:LucW1/34 |
Price:
£11.00
|
Donor
- University of Edinburgh Andrew Millar
- University of Edinburgh Adrian Thomson
|
Locus
|
Stock type: individual line
|
Material type: seed
|
|
Description Produced by crossing parent CCR2:LUC W1 (deposited with this stock: 9808) to the lhy-21, cca1-11 mutant (stock N9380). Non-segregating LUC+ line selected. Homozygosity of the mutations verified by morphological phenotype and PCR. N9380 was produced by crossing two mutant lines from the Wisconsin T-DNA knockout collection. The CCR2:LUC W1 parent carries a fusion of CCR2 (AtGRP7, At2g21660) upstream region to the LUC+ firefly luciferase reporter gene (from Promega), as described in Doyle et al. (2002) Nature 419: 74-77.
|
Phenotype
The lhy, cca1 double mutants severely affect flowering time, light responses and circadian rhythms.
